Please find a Bible and read 2 Chronicles 20:1-30 in sections according to this outline.
[It is a fascinating story. You won’t regret spending time on it.]

  1. The Coalition Comes on. – vs. 1,2
  2. The Cry Goes Up. – vs. 3-12
  3. The Confidence Comes Down. – vs. 13-17
  4. The Choir Goes Out. – vs. 18-21
  5. The Coalition Comes Apart. – vs. 22,23
  6. The Collection Goes Well. – vs. 24-26
  7. The Conquerors Come Home. – vs.27,28
  8. The CONQUEROR Gives Rest. – vs. 29,30
[This historical account took place about 840 B.C. Old Testament accounts of battles against physical enemies need to be applied today as battles against our three enemies, Satan, the world system that has set itself against God, and sexual immorality.]

IN THE FEAR OF THE LORD THERE IS STRONG CONFIDENCE – Prov. 14:26
Please notice what the prophet Jahaziel said to King Jehoshaphat and his subjects about the three armies that were threatening them:
“DO NOT BE AFRAID OR DISMAYED [DISCOURAGED],... FOR THE BATTLE IS NOT YOURS, BUT GOD’S.”

Why did the prophet of God say this to the King?
  1. Because the king and his small army were afraid of the massive host march-ing toward them.
  2. Because King Jehoshaphat had prayed,
“We have no power against this great multitude;... nor do we know what to do, but our eyes are upon You [God].”
Remember: “Fearing God = Having a reverential awe of Him, trusting Him and loving Him.”
As illustrated by this story, what can we learn from the answers to the following questions?
  1. When we are afraid of people, circumstances, or spiritual powers, what can we do?
  2. When we ask God for His help, what should we expect?
  3. How can we show God that we totally trust Him to “win the battle” for us?
